Ingredients
- 1/3 cup shortening
- 1 3/4 cups flour
- 2 1/2 tsp. baking powder
- 3/4 tsp. salt
- 3/4 cup milk
Preparation
Step 1
450 oven. Cut shortening into flour, baking powder and salt with pastry blender until mixture resembles fine crumbs. Stir in just enough milk so dough leaves side of bowl and rounds up into a ball. (Too much milk makes dough sticky; not enough makes biscuits dry.)
Put on lightly floured surface. Knead lightly 10 times. (Kneading improves texture.) Roll 1/2 inch thick. Cut with floured 2 inch biscuit cutter. Place on ungreased cookie sheet about 1 inch apart for crusty sides, touching for soft sides. Bake until golden brown, 10-12 minutes. Immediately remove from cookie sheet.
Drop Biscuits: Increase milk to 1 cup. Drop dough by spoonfuls onto greased cookie sheet.
